Transaction 23175da830028d23aa511e2c110e3d4cccfda08c77979f3d88adf5d97a64e590
1 Input
1 Output
-
23175da830028d23aa511e2c110e3d4cccfda08c77979f3d88adf5d97a64e590:0
- value
- 46182
- script pubkey
- OP_0 OP_PUSHBYTES_20 07afbc5696f2f1fd87c7395b2f2a9655fbdf62d7
- address
- bc1qq7hmc45k7tclmp7889dj725k2haa7ckhpgy3m0